Nemo

Nemo

File Management File Manager
Nemo is the default and highly customizable file manager for the Cinnamon desktop environment. It offers a robust set of features for managing files and folders efficiently, including multi-pane views, tabbed browsing, extensibility via plugins, and an integrated terminal for advanced users.

Nautilus

Nautilus

File Management File Manager
Nautilus, also known as GNOME Files, is the official file manager for the GNOME desktop environment. It provides a user-friendly interface for managing files and folders, offering features like file preview, search, and network drive support.

htop

htop

OS & Utilities System Monitoring
htop is an advanced interactive system monitor and process viewer for Unix-like systems. It offers a user-friendly, cursor-based interface to manage processes, providing real-time performance data and powerful process control capabilities.
